Q: Is 1,857,485 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,857,485 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,857,485 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1857485 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 35 73 365 511 727 2,555 3,635 5,089 25,445 53,071 265,355 371,497 and 1,857,485, with no remainder.

Since 1,857,485 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,857,485, it is not a prime number.
